We are one of the fastest growing businesses in the UK for Vehicle Coach Building. Alongside hands-on practical skills, you will have excellent communication and interpersonal skills, dealing with a variety of tasks in a polite and professional manner, with an awareness of health and safety within a workshop environment.
About You
- Ideally you will have good coachbuilding/bodybuilding experience and may have worked in a variety of roles.
- A full UK driving licence would be an advantage but not essential.
- Positive, with a can-do attitude.
- Will have some practical experience working in a similar role or trade.
- A willingness to train.

How to prepare for a job interview at LYNDON SYSTEMS LTD
✨Show Off Your Practical Skills
Make sure to highlight any hands-on experience you have in coach building or vehicle fitting. Bring along examples of your work or be ready to discuss specific projects you've completed. This will demonstrate your practical skills and give the interviewer confidence in your abilities.
✨Communicate Clearly and Professionally
Since excellent communication is key for this role, practice articulating your thoughts clearly. Be polite and professional in your responses, and don’t hesitate to ask questions if you need clarification. This shows that you’re engaged and interested in the conversation.
✨Demonstrate Your Health and Safety Awareness
Familiarise yourself with health and safety protocols relevant to a workshop environment. Be prepared to discuss how you’ve adhered to these in past roles or how you would approach safety in this new position. This will show that you take workplace safety seriously.
✨Bring a Positive Attitude
A can-do attitude can set you apart from other candidates. During the interview, express your enthusiasm for the role and your willingness to learn and adapt. Share examples of how you’ve tackled challenges positively in the past to reinforce this trait.
